Question 199: To ask the Minister for Finance the reason VAT at 21% is charged on the provision of caring services for the elderly. [5823/06]

The application of VAT in these cases is governed by EU law. This requires that private providers of home care services must charge VAT at the appropriate rate of up to 21%. My Department is actively examining, in consultation with the Department of Health and Children, the scope within the relevant EU directives to exempt the provision of such services from VAT in the future.
